Requirements/Prior Knowledge

You will need a valid PPL(H) or CPL(H) license for the training.

Theoretical training

The theoretical training comprises at least 7.5 hours and provides you with comprehensive specialist knowledge about the R22.

Structure and systems: Helicopter construction, power transmission (gearbox), rotors and equipment.

Operation: Normal operation of the systems and their malfunctions, operating limits, flight performance, flight planning and monitoring.

Safety: Loading, center of gravity, emergency procedures, and additional equipment. This knowledge is crucial for the safe and efficient handling of the R22.

practical training

The practical training includes at least 5 hours of flight time and focuses on the application of what has been learned .

Acclimatization flight: Familiarizing yourself with the helicopter.

Procedure training: Intensive practice of normal and emergency procedures.

Instrument training: Fundamentals of instrument use. The course usually lasts 2 to 3 days . After successfully completing the practical exam, you are authorized to fly the Robinson R22.
